Abstract
In this work, the existence of solutions of mm-point boundary problems for second-order dynamic inclusions on time scales is investigated. The main approach used here is based on a fixed point theorem due to Sadovskii together with a continuous selection theorem for lower semi-continuous multi-valued maps.
